Institution: Maribor Grammar School II, Maribor, Slovenia
Education level: Upper secondary (age 16 - 19)
Description:
The school is located in Maribor, in North East Slovenia, within walking distance from the city centre. The school has a long tradition and a reputation of a school which is committed to offering its students a firm academic foundation for further study and a possibility to develop into creative, open-minded individuals, who will be prepared to work in an international atmosphere of cooperation and tolerance. Approximately 800 students are enrolled every academic year and they are divided into 29 classes. 60 teachers teach at the school.
Institution: the Faculty of Education in Ljubljana, Ljubljana, Slovenia
Education level: Educates future teachers for the primary and secondary level of education.
Description:
The Faculty of Education is a part of University of Ljubljana. It is situated at the Bežigrad university campus at the north of the city centre of Ljubljana. The evolution of the Faculty of Education began with the founding of the College of Education on 4 July 1947, the activities of which were intended to train teachers for primary and secondary schools of the day offering single honour and joint honour degree programmes. Single degree programmes comprise Primary Education, Art Education, Social Pedagogy, Special and Rehabilitation Education and Pre-school Education. In joint degree programme, students take two subjects choosing between: Biology, Chemistry, Computing, Mathematics, Physics and Technical studies.
The list above confirms that the Faculty offers a wide variety of courses and enables employment for future teachers of pre-school, primary, secondary and art education. Working in partnerships with educational institutions, the students are able to develop their theoretical knowledge gained at the faculty which is then enriched with practical experience and supported by the experienced and capable mentor teachers. The Faculty continues to have many bilateral agreements with a number of educational institutions across Europe and in 2007, 43 students and 23 university teachers spent part of their study/working time at one of the foreign universities
